Rohit leaves nets after blow to thigh

India’s T20I skipper Rohit Sharma was hit on his left thigh while batting in the nets at the Arun Jaitley Stadium in New Delhi yesterday, forcing him to leave the net session ahead of Sunday’s first T20I against Bangladesh. 

Sharma, who will lead India in the three-match series in Virat Kohli’s absence, received the blow while taking throwdowns to simulate batting against Bangladesh’s left-arm fast bowlers. After a few throwdowns, one sharp delivery hit Sharma on his left thigh. He immediately left the nets and was not at all happy with the pace at which the ball was hurled at him.

It was learnt that Sharma was getting treatment for the blow and didn’t take further part in the net session. 

It is understood that Indian batsmen are particularly training how to counter Bangladesh’s left-arm paceman Mustafizur Rahman.
